Best Dining Areas in Noosa
Hastings Street
Hastings Street is Noosa’s best-known dining precinct. The area contains cafés, restaurants, dessert venues, takeaway food and beachfront dining options within walking distance of Main Beach.
- Beachfront dining atmosphere
- Breakfast, lunch and dinner options
- Popular visitor precinct
- Walkable from accommodation and Main Beach
Noosaville
Noosaville is centred around the Noosa River and Gympie Terrace. It is known for relaxed waterfront dining, cafés and family-friendly eating areas.
- Riverfront dining
- Cafés and casual restaurants
- Family-friendly atmosphere
- Popular walking and dining precinct
Sunshine Beach
Sunshine Beach offers a smaller coastal village atmosphere with cafés, casual dining and beachside food options close to the surf beach.
- Beach village atmosphere
- Relaxed dining environment
- Popular with locals and visitors
Noosa Junction
Noosa Junction is one of the area's main commercial centres and contains cafés, bakeries, takeaway food outlets and casual dining venues.
- Local dining hub
- Convenient parking and access
- Broad range of food choices
Tewantin
Tewantin provides a quieter alternative to the tourism-focused areas, with cafés, bakeries and dining venues serving locals and visitors alike.
